Output fc3053e6682a9e54c9a12a38699cb97bee7188858925ef42df261fc7e45f67b9:2

value
826879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6124a5f86fac7b5a667a41a0907ea0c8f993d6f3 OP_EQUAL
address
3AYfNXC81izExWTiHDQNwz2ppxbyYoZ6h7
transaction
fc3053e6682a9e54c9a12a38699cb97bee7188858925ef42df261fc7e45f67b9
spent
true